(Rebirth + Times Literature + Entrepreneurship) In the autumn of 1993, 45-year-old Chen Xiangdong died lonely in the wave of the times, but he opened his eyes and returned to the third-grade junior high school classroom in Hongkou Alley. In his previous life, he was a bankrupt and frustrated businessman who saw his relatives separated; in this life, he holds vague memories of the future, but is no longer an omniscient god.
This is a story about "making up" and "taking root". He wanted to break into the steel factory workshop on the eve of his father's work injury, force his mother into the medical examination room before she coughed up blood, and hold back his childhood friends and close friends who should have fallen. From a 5-square-meter clothing stall on Huating Road to an office building on the east bank of the Pujiang River, he relied on his subtle memory of Shanghai's urban changes to explore among fabrics, bricks, and codes.
But rebirth is not a panacea. Inherited high blood pressure follows him everywhere, and his forward thinking hit a wall in the 1990s. But deep down emotionally, he is still afraid of intimacy and commitment. In the fireworks at Shikumen and in the ripples of the Suzhou River, Chen Xiangdong, his family, and partners jointly performed a Shanghai narrative of the defectives dancing with the times - not a Shuangwen-style crushing, but clumsily and tenaciously making regrets worth living in every ebb and flow of the tide.
